UNEMPLOYMENT.

BIG DEMONSTRATION IN ADELAIDE. (BT CABLE-PRESS ASSOCIATIOK-COPYRIQHT.) (AUSTBALIAH AND H.Z CABLE ASSOCIATION t (Received November 28th, 11.5 p.m.) ADELAIDE, November 28. The unemployed assembled a thousand strong at the Treasury buildings and attempted to force a way in to interview the Premier. The doors were euarded by police, who drew their batons and kept the crowd back. . The Premier undertook to interview the leaders to-morrow.
